Where this word comes from

From Old Danish pænning, Old Norse peningr, borrowed from Old Saxon penning or Old English penning, peniġ, from Proto-Germanic *panningaz (“coin”). Cognate with English penny and German Pfennig. This word is the source of the common word for "money" in modern Scandinavian, see penge.
